Multivalent cationic and anionic mixed redox of an Sb<sub>2</sub>S<sub>3</sub> cathode toward high-capacity aluminum ion batteries
Tongge Li, Tonghui Cai, Haoyu Hu, Xuejin Li, Dandan Wang, Yu Zhang, Yongpeng Cui, Lianming Zhao, Wei Xing, Zifeng Yan
Abstract
A multivalent Sb-related cation (Sb(+3) ⇔ Sb(+5)) and S-related anion (S(−2) ⇔ S(0)) mixed redox Sb 2 S 3 cathode breaks the capacity limit of conventional metal sulfides and enables high-capacity aluminum-ion batteries.
